Effects of adiposity and body composition on adjusted resting energy expenditure in women
American Journal of Human Biology ( IF 2.9 ) Pub Date : 2021-05-07 , DOI: 10.1002/ajhb.23610
Lacey M Gould 1 , Katie R Hirsch 1, 2 , Malia N M Blue 1, 2, 3 , Hannah E Cabre 1, 2 , Gabrielle J Brewer 1, 3 , Abbie E Smith-Ryan 4, 5, 6
Affiliation  

Fat-free mass (FFM) accounts for ~80% of the variance in resting energy expenditure (REE), and this relationship is complicated by adiposity. The objective was to compare adjusted REE and contributions of skeletal lean mass and fat mass (FM) to adjusted REE in women with varying adiposity levels using a novel approach.
